Investors Alert: Lawsuit Notification for Li-Cycle Holdings Corp. LICY Shareholders with Lead Plaintiff Deadline on January 8, 2024

Published November 22, 2023

New York-based investors who have acquired shares in Li-Cycle Holdings Corp. LICY are being notified of an ongoing class action lawsuit. The complaint, filed by The Law Offices of Vincent Wong, targets the period from June 14, 2022, to October 23, 2023. This legal action represents those who invested in LICY during the mentioned timeframe and is a consequence of alleged corporate misdeeds that have negatively impacted the investment community.

Understanding the Class Action

The lawsuit commenced by The Law Offices of Vincent Wong alleges that Li-Cycle Holdings Corp. may have provided misinformation to investors or failed to disclose critical company developments. This alleged lack of transparency could have led to significant losses for unaware shareholders. Awareness of this issue is crucial for those who have made investments in LICY shares during the specified period and are considering their legal rights and options.

Guidelines for Affected Investors

Investors who purchased LICY shares between June 14, 2022, and October 23, 2023, and incurred losses are reminded that January 8, 2024, is the deadline to apply as a lead plaintiff in the lawsuit.
